Graduated from the University of Alberta with a degree in law. Worked as a lawyer before entering politics. Served as a Member of Parliament from 2006 to 2015, representing Abbotsford in British Columbia. Held the position of Minister of International Trade from 2013 to 2015. Contributed to trade negotiations, enhancing Canada's economic relations with other countries.
